Twenty-eight-year-old Even Grade is a Black man who was orphaned as a child. 15-year-old Valuable Korner is a White girl who might as well have been orphaned. Petal, Mississippi, circa 1956, seems an unlikely spot for these two to connect, but a friendship forged across race lines is just one of many miracles waiting to happen in this small Southern town.
Their paths cross through Joody Two Sun, a seer with amazing powers. Forming something that resembles a family, they discover priceless things they never had: unconditional love, human connection, and enduring commitment.
